人机界面编程软件叫什么
-
人机界面编程软件通常被称为人机界面开发工具或者人机界面设计软件。常见的人机界面编程软件包括LabVIEW、Qt、HMI/SCADA软件等。以下将介绍LabVIEW和Qt这两个常用的人机界面编程软件。
L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一款由美国国家仪器公司开发的图形化编程环境和开发平台。它具有直观的图形化界面,使用户能够通过拖拽和连接图标来编写程序,而无需编写传统的代码。LabVIEW主要用于测量、测试和控制系统的开发,适用于各种领域,如工业自动化、科学研究、医学仪器等。LabVIEW提供了丰富的函数库和工具箱,可以轻松实现各种数据采集、数据处理、仪器控制等功能。
Qt是一款跨平台的C++应用程序开发框架,也被广泛应用于人机界面开发。Qt提供了丰富的GUI(图形用户界面)组件和工具,能够快速构建现代化的用户界面。Qt具有良好的可移植性和扩展性,可以在多个操作系统上运行,包括Windows、Linux、macOS等。Qt还提供了强大的信号与槽机制,使得开发者能够方便地处理用户交互、事件响应等功能。Qt广泛应用于各种领域,如嵌入式系统、移动应用、汽车电子等。
综上所述,LabVIEW和Qt是两个常用的人机界面编程软件,它们都提供了丰富的功能和工具,能够帮助开发者快速设计和开发出直观、易用的用户界面。选择哪个软件取决于具体的需求和项目要求。
1年前 -
人机界面编程软件通常被称为人机界面开发工具或人机界面设计软件。以下是一些常见的人机界面编程软件的名称:
-
LabVIEW:LabVIEW是一种由National Instruments开发的图形化编程环境,用于设计和开发人机界面。它可以在不同平台上运行,并具有丰富的图形化编程功能。
-
Qt:Qt是一种跨平台的应用程序和用户界面开发框架,可用于开发各种人机界面应用程序。它提供了丰富的界面组件和工具,使开发人员能够轻松创建各种用户界面。
-
Visual Studio:Visual Studio是一种集成开发环境(IDE),用于开发各种应用程序,包括人机界面应用程序。它提供了丰富的工具和功能,使开发人员能够轻松创建和调试人机界面。
-
Adobe XD:Adobe XD是一种用于设计和原型制作的界面设计软件。它提供了丰富的设计工具和功能,使设计师能够创建漂亮和交互式的人机界面。
-
HMI软件:HMI(Human Machine Interface)软件是一种专门用于开发人机界面的软件。它提供了丰富的界面组件和功能,使开发人员能够快速构建和定制人机界面。
这些软件都提供了各种工具和功能,使开发人员能够轻松创建、调试和定制人机界面,以满足不同应用领域的需求。
1年前 -
-
人机界面编程软件有很多种,常见的有LabVIEW、Qt、C#.NET、Java等。下面将以LabVIEW为例,详细介绍人机界面编程的方法和操作流程。
LabVIEW是一种图形化编程语言,它通过拖拽和连接图标来创建程序。它具有直观的用户界面,可以轻松地创建可视化的人机界面。
一、LabVIEW的安装和准备工作
- 下载LabVIEW软件并安装在计算机上。
- 打开LabVIEW软件,进入开发环境。
二、创建新的人机界面
- 点击“新建”按钮,选择“新建VI”。
- 在界面上拖拽需要的控件,如按钮、文本框、图表等。可以在工具箱中找到这些控件。
- 连接控件之间的线,建立数据流程。可以使用连接线工具或者按住Ctrl键进行连接。
三、设置控件的属性
- 双击控件,打开属性窗口。
- 在属性窗口中,可以设置控件的外观、大小、位置等属性。
- 还可以设置控件的行为,例如按钮的点击事件、文本框的输入限制等。
四、编写程序逻辑
- 在界面上双击空白处,进入编程界面。
- 使用LabVIEW提供的函数和工具,编写程序逻辑。可以使用结构化编程语言,如顺序结构、循环结构、条件结构等。
- 可以使用图形化的数据流程图来表示程序的逻辑。
五、调试和测试
- 点击“运行”按钮,运行程序。
- 在界面上输入测试数据,观察程序的运行结果。
- 如果发现问题,可以通过调试工具来查找和修复错误。
六、部署和发布人机界面
- 点击“部署”按钮,选择需要部署的目标平台,如Windows、Linux等。
- 设置部署选项,如输出路径、文件名等。
- 点击“部署”按钮,将人机界面程序打包成可执行文件或安装包。
总结:
人机界面编程软件可以帮助开发者快速创建直观的用户界面,并与程序逻辑进行连接。LabVIEW是一种常见的人机界面编程软件,通过拖拽和连接图标来创建程序。在创建人机界面时,需要设置控件的属性,编写程序逻辑,并进行调试和测试。最后,可以将人机界面部署和发布为可执行文件或安装包。1年前